Lonesome Jim is a 2005 American comedy/drama film directed by actor/filmmaker Steve Buscemi. Filmed mostly in the city of Goshen, Indiana, the film stars Casey Affleck as a chronically depressed aspiring writer who moves back into his parents' home after failing to make it in New York City.

After failing to find success as a writer in New York City, Jim slinks back to his family's home in the Midwest to lick his wounds. But his visit is quickly complicated when his angst spreads to his brother, Tim, who promptly decides to drive his car straight into a tree.

Steve Buscemi's comedy follows Jim as he returns to life in his rural Indiana hometown. This film stars Casey Affleck, Liv Tyler and Mary Kay Place and was nominated for the Grand Jury Prize at Sundance.
